Adventurer, Academic, Industrialist: Louis Pierre Ledoux 1936 New Guinea Expedition
In early 1936, on recommendation by American anthropologist Margaret Mead, Louis Pierre Ledoux, recent Harvard University graduate, headed to the lower eastern Sepik River of Papua New Guinea to study the Murik people.
The results of his self-funded expedition is an extraordinary collection of hundreds of artifacts, photographs, manuscripts, diaries, and letters left untouched for 85 years.

3 Maps of New Guinea in 1961, 1962, and 1964
1961 Map of Hollandia Netherlands New Guinea - Territory of New Guinea (23" x 58" )
1962 Map of Fly River Netherlands New Guinea - Territory of New Guinea - Territory of Papua (23.5" x 59")
1964 Map of Territory of Papua and New Guinea (29.5" x 75").
Maps are compiled and drawn by the Division of National Mapping, Department of National Development, Canberra, ACT.
All maps have staining, tears and holes.
